John Moore is a renowned equine development professional in America. Some may call John a horse behaviourist, although he does not like the title… he prefers to think of himself as providing equine educational opportunities for humans to understand what our horses are thinking, feeling, and why. Dr David Marlin has asked John to share a few of his thoughts and learnings about horse behaviour with us. The interview was conducted over Zoom as John is based in Montana in the USA.  In the coming months, we hope to have John on to discuss various aspects of how horse behaviour is important to how we keep and care for our horses. We hope to cover topics including; when science meets behaviour, demographic differences, horses are ever naughty, spotting a horse's reaction to pain and other interesting subjects.
